Class: Properb::Generators::SizedGenerator
- Inherits:
-
Properb::Generator
- Object
- Properb::Generator
- Properb::Generators::SizedGenerator
- Defined in:
- lib/properb/generators/sized_generator.rb
Instance Method Summary collapse
- #generate_value(random, _size) ⇒ Object
-
#initialize(generator, size) ⇒ SizedGenerator
constructor
A new instance of SizedGenerator.
Methods inherited from Properb::Generator
#map, #or, #reject, #select, #sized, #to_properb_generator
Constructor Details
#initialize(generator, size) ⇒ SizedGenerator
Returns a new instance of SizedGenerator.
4 5 6 7 |
# File 'lib/properb/generators/sized_generator.rb', line 4 def initialize(generator, size) @generator = generator @size = size end |
Instance Method Details
#generate_value(random, _size) ⇒ Object
9 10 11 |
# File 'lib/properb/generators/sized_generator.rb', line 9 def generate_value(random, _size) @generator.generate_value(random, @size) end |